A unique and beautiful album that features the avant-garde master Roland Kirk exclusively on an array of flutes. The standout track, 'Serenade to a Cuckoo,' later made famous by rock band Jethro Tull, is a charming and deeply soulful melody. The performance is a showcase for Kirk's revolutionary flute technique, in which he often hummed or sang while playing, creating a rich, multi-layered sound. It reveals a surprisingly tender and folk-influenced side of this visionary artist.
